Comparison Overview

The primary numerical divergence between the 2025 Hyundai Palisade (Car 1) and the 2025 Toyota Highlander (Car 2) lies in their initial pricing, with the Palisade starting $3,120 lower at an MSRP of $37,200 compared to the Highlander's $40,320. This price gap presents a value proposition against the Highlander's superior fuel economy, achieving 25 combined MPG versus the Palisade's 22 combined MPG. Conversely, the Palisade offers a measurable power advantage with 291 horsepower against the Highlander's 265 horsepower, although the Highlander counters with 310 lb-ft of torque, exceeding the Palisade's 262 lb-ft. Dimensionally, the Palisade is longer by 1.8 inches (196.7 inches vs 194.9 inches) and boasts greater cargo space at 18 cu ft compared to the Highlander's 16 cu ft. Both utilize regular unleaded fuel and an 8-speed automatic transmission, but the Highlander saves slightly on fuel costs over time due to its efficiency metrics.

Engine
Feature Hyundai Toyota
Base Engine Displacement 3.8 L 2.4 L
Number of Cylinders V6 inline 4
Base Engine Type gas gas
Horsepower 291 hp @ 6000 rpm 265 hp @ 6000 rpm
Torque 262 lb-ft @ 5200 rpm 310 lb-ft @ 1700 rpm
Number of Valves 24 16
Camshaft Type Double overhead cam (DOHC) Double overhead cam (DOHC)
Variable Valve Timing Variable Variable
Fuel Injection Type โœ“ โœ“
Drive Train
Feature Hyundai Toyota
Transmission Type 8-speed shiftable automatic 8-speed shiftable automatic
Drivetrain Type front wheel drive front wheel drive
Fuel
Feature Hyundai Toyota
Fuel Type regular unleaded regular unleaded
EPA Fuel Economy (City/Highway) 19/26 MPG 22/29 MPG
EPA Fuel Economy (Combined) 22 MPG 25 MPG
EPA Driving Range (City/Highway) 357.2/488.8 mi. 393.8/519.1 mi.
Fuel Tank Capacity 18.8 gal. 17.9 gal.

Warranty
Feature Hyundai Toyota
Basic Warranty 5 yr./ 60000 mi. 3 yr./ 36000 mi.
Drivetrain Warranty 10 yr./ 100000 mi. 5 yr./ 60000 mi.
Corrosion/Rust Warranty 7 yr./ unlimited mi. 5 yr./ unlimited mi.
Roadside Assistance 5 yr./ unlimited mi. 2 yr./ unlimited mi.
Complimentary Scheduled Maintenance 3 yr./ 36000 mi. 2 yr./ 25000 mi.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about comparing the 2025 Hyundai Palisade and 2025 Toyota Highlander.

Which vehicle provides better fuel economy for highway driving?

The 2025 Toyota Highlander offers superior highway efficiency, rating at 29 MPG compared to the 2025 Hyundai Palisade's 26 MPG highway rating. This 3 MPG difference suggests the Highlander will require fewer fuel stops on extended trips.

How do the engine specifications compare regarding horsepower and torque?

The Hyundai Palisade generates more horsepower at 291 hp, while the Toyota Highlander compensates with significantly higher torque at 310 lb-ft versus the Palisade's 262 lb-ft. Both use regular unleaded fuel.

Is there a substantial difference in base price between the two crossovers?

Yes, the numerical difference is $3,120, with the 2025 Hyundai Palisade starting at $37,200 and the 2025 Toyota Highlander listed at $40,320 for the base trim levels.

Which vehicle has more interior space for cargo behind the rear seats?

The 2025 Hyundai Palisade offers 18 cubic feet of cargo capacity, giving it a 2 cubic foot advantage over the 2025 Toyota Highlander, which is rated at 16 cubic feet.

Are the exterior dimensions significantly different between the two models?

The dimensions are closely matched; the Palisade is 1.8 inches longer (196.7 inches vs 194.9 inches) and notably wider and taller than the Highlander. Both share a front-wheel-drive configuration.

Do both vehicles require premium gasoline?

No, both the 2025 Hyundai Palisade and the 2025 Toyota Highlander specify the use of regular unleaded fuel for their respective engines.
